Output 71d403962cd173b6dc2ed16871fb856cc44cf44e709a922fc095aa05d4b0ee80:0

value
29494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f4d4af498fa587a7d6ab4d5388c3d61b9c0e9c OP_EQUAL
address
3CzSLHFp8qsfFkHWmJLGYKYrWFwyKjZe4a
transaction
71d403962cd173b6dc2ed16871fb856cc44cf44e709a922fc095aa05d4b0ee80
confirmations
91070
spent
true